Increase Employee Retention

Highly engaged employees were 87% less likely to leave their companies. They become connected and are ignited to do more because they understand that the company have a stake in them.
In return, Loyalty — an emotional word that can be derived only from emotional rewards – helps retain talents. The way they “feel” about the company determines how they act in relation to external opportunities. Companies that can channel extraordinary experiences that rewards their five senses can fuel long-lasting emotional loyalty.
The Millennial workforce are good at deriving brand value. Many cite the clear void when it comes to employee recognition for the work they put in, as the most common reasons given at exit interviews – a group who will make up 50% of the workforce by 2020.
The modern workforce has changed. To get that 1% growth every single day, you need to do more than just provide your team with basic training resources and videos. They need to be connected with the company, the reward’s brand value, and be inspired with the rewards experience that will translate to loyalty and talent retention.

Reward Experiences designed based on Behavioural Science

People are driven by financial gains, recognition, and the status symbol of having achieved. Momentus ONE focuses on leveraging the specific impacts of recognition and status symbol, using behavioural science to milk the most out of the physical rewards delivered. It is the process of the Reward Experience that matters, not just the reward item.
Studies from behaviour science show that the idea of receiving something unique, exquisite, or reputable is a far stronger motivating factor than simple discounts. Augmented reward value and its associations are what drives results. Moreover, research shows that the number of businesses using non-cash rewards has risen from 26% in 1996 to 86% in 2018 (Incentive Research Foundation).

With behavioural science, we utilise

  • Mental Accounting – how people remember the impact of a reward, where experiences can evoke much stronger and longer-lasting emotions than transactional benefits.
  • Effort Justification – how people place greater than market value on things they have worked to build or achieve. 
  • Social Signalling – how people like to be seen rewarded in public and among their community, more than just being rewarded in private.
